OpenClaw安装教程:从零到一的完整指南(2026最新版)
OpenClaw(曾用名Clawdbot、Moltbot)是2026年初爆火的开源AI智能体框架,它不仅仅是一个对话AI,更是一个能真正“动手”帮你操作电脑、处理任务的数字管家。本文将为你提供最详细的OpenClaw安装配置教程,涵盖Windows、macOS和Linux三大平台,适合初学者快速上手。
一、OpenClaw是什么?
OpenClaw是一个开源的个人AI智能体框架,其核心定位是基于大语言模型的自动化执行器。与传统AI助手不同,OpenClaw具备真正的“代理权”,能够直接操作你的文件系统、浏览器、应用程序等,实现从“动口”到“动手”的转变。
核心特点:
- 本地优先:数据不上传云端,保护隐私安全
- 开源免费:基于MIT协议,社区活跃
- 持续在线:7x24小时后台运行
- 低门槛:自然语言指令,无需编程基础
二、环境准备
2.1 系统要求
- 操作系统:Windows 10/11(64位)、macOS 10.15+、Linux(Ubuntu 20.04+)
- 内存:≥4GB(推荐8GB+)
- 磁盘空间:≥5GB
- 网络:稳定互联网连接
2.2 软件依赖
- Node.js:版本≥22(安装脚本会自动检测并安装)
- Git:用于拉取代码和依赖(Windows用户可能需要手动安装)
三、安装OpenClaw
3.1 Windows系统安装(三种方案)
方案一:一键脚本安装(推荐给新手)
这是最简单快捷的方式,适合快速体验:
-
以管理员身份打开PowerShell
- 按Win+X,选择“Windows PowerShell(管理员)”
- 或搜索PowerShell,右键选择“以管理员身份运行”
-
解锁执行策略(如遇报错)
Set-ExecutionPolicy -ExecutionPolicy RemoteSigned -Scope CurrentUser输入
Y确认 -
执行一键安装命令
iwr -useb https://openclaw.ai/install.ps1 | iex如果下载缓慢,可使用国内镜像:
iwr -useb https://clawd.org.cn/install.ps1 | iex脚本会自动检查并安装所需环境
方案二:WSL2安装(官方推荐,稳定性最佳)
OpenClaw主要为类Unix环境设计,通过WSL2运行可获得最佳兼容性:
-
安装WSL2和Ubuntu
wsl --install -d Ubuntu-22.04 wsl --set-default-version 2安装完成后重启电脑
-
进入WSL环境并安装
- 重启后打开PowerShell,输入
wsl进入Ubuntu - 执行Linux安装命令:
curl -fsSL https://openclaw.ai/install.sh | bash
- 重启后打开PowerShell,输入
方案三:npm手动安装(适合有技术基础)
如果已安装Node.js 22+,可手动安装:
npm install -g openclaw@latest
3.2 macOS/Linux系统安装
一键安装(推荐)
curl -fsSL https://openclaw.ai/install.sh | bash
npm安装
npm install -g openclaw@latest
3.3 验证安装
安装完成后,验证是否成功:
openclaw --version
出现版本号(如2026.3.x)即表示安装成功。
四、初始化配置
4.1 启动配置向导
执行以下命令启动交互式配置向导:
openclaw onboard --install-daemon
或使用快速启动模式:
openclaw onboard --flow quickstart
4.2 配置选项详解
向导会引导你完成以下配置:
| 配置项 | 选项 | 推荐选择 | 说明 |
|---|---|---|---|
| 模式选择 | QuickStart/Advanced | QuickStart | 新手选QuickStart,自动配置基础参数 |
| 模型提供方 | Qwen/OpenAI/Skip for now | Qwen | 国内用户选Qwen,可直接访问 |
| 默认模型 | qwen-portal/coder-model | 默认 | 保持默认即可 |
| 通道配置 | Telegram/WhatsApp/Skip for now | Skip for now | 国内用户先跳过,后续配置飞书 |
| 技能配置 | Yes/No | Yes | 启用基础功能模块 |
| 技能安装工具 | npm/pnpm/bun | npm | 兼容性最好 |
| API密钥配置 | No/Yes | No | 国内用户先跳过 |
4.3 配置大模型API(可选但推荐)
OpenClaw需要连接大模型才能工作,以下是国内常用配置:
豆包API配置(国内首选)
# 配置默认提供商为豆包
openclaw config set --key llm.default.provider --value doubao
# 填入豆包Secret Key
openclaw config set --key llm.default.apiKey --value 你的豆包Secret Key
# 配置API地址
openclaw config set --key llm.default.baseUrl --value https://ark.cn-beijing.volces.com/api/v3
# 设置默认模型
openclaw config set --key llm.default.model --value doubao-pro
DeepSeek API配置
openclaw config set --key llm.default.provider --value deepseek
openclaw config set --key llm.default.apiKey --value 你的DeepSeek API密钥
五、启动与测试验证
5.1 启动网关服务
# 启动网关(默认端口18789)
openclaw gateway
# 或以后台服务方式启动
openclaw daemon start
5.2 访问Web控制台
启动成功后,在浏览器中访问:
http://127.0.0.1:18789
或使用命令直接打开:
openclaw dashboard
5.3 系统状态检查
# 查看服务状态
openclaw gateway status
# 全面系统诊断
openclaw doctor
# 查看运行状态
openclaw status
# 测试API连通性
openclaw llm test --provider doubao
5.4 基础功能测试
- 文件操作测试:在Web控制台输入“帮我创建一个test.txt文件”
- 网页浏览测试:输入“打开百度首页”
- 信息查询测试:输入“今天的天气怎么样”
六、配置飞书通道(国内用户)
6.1 创建飞书应用
- 访问https://open.feishu.cn/app,创建“企业自建应用”
- 获取App ID和App Secret
6.2 配置OpenClaw
-
安装飞书插件
openclaw plugins install @m1heng-clawd/feishu -
编辑配置文件
打开~/.openclaw/openclaw.json(Windows:C:\Users\用户名\.openclaw\openclaw.json),添加:"channels": { "feishu": { "enabled": true, "appId": "你的App ID", "appSecret": "你的App Secret", "connectionMode": "websocket" } } -
重启服务
openclaw gateway restart
6.3 飞书权限配置
在飞书开放平台中:
- 权限管理:使用官方提供的JSON配置批量导入所需权限
- 事件与订阅:配置订阅方式为“使用长连接接收事件”
- 添加事件:添加
im.message.receive_v1事件
七、常见问题与解决方案
7.1 安装问题
| 问题 | 解决方案 |
|---|---|
| 执行脚本提示“策略禁止运行脚本” | Set-ExecutionPolicy RemoteSigned -Scope CurrentUser |
| 命令找不到openclaw | 关闭所有终端重新打开,或手动添加PATH:%APPDATA%\npm |
| 国内网络慢 | 切换npm镜像:npm config set registry https://registry.npmmirror.com |
| 端口18789被占用 | `netstat -ano |
7.2 运行问题
| 问题 | 解决方案 |
|---|---|
| Gateway启动失败 | 检查Node.js版本≥22,运行openclaw doctor诊断 |
| API连接超时 | 检查网络代理设置,国内API无需代理 |
| 权限错误 | 不要使用root权限运行,修复目录权限:sudo chown -R $USER:$(id -gn) ~/.openclaw |
7.3 配置问题
| 问题 | 解决方案 |
|---|---|
| 修改配置不生效 | 修改后必须重启服务:openclaw gateway restart |
| 飞书连接失败 | 检查App ID/Secret,确认权限配置完整 |
| 模型无响应 | 检查API密钥是否正确,余额是否充足 |
八、安全注意事项
⚠️ 重要警告:OpenClaw拥有文件读写与命令执行权限,请务必谨慎使用。
- 权限最小化:不要使用root或管理员权限运行
- 严格审查:永远不要批准来源不明的Pairing请求
- 人工确认:默认情况下,危险操作(如删除文件)需要二次确认
- 环境隔离:建议在Docker或虚拟机中运行重要任务
九、进阶使用建议
9.1 技能扩展
OpenClaw通过ClawHub插件系统扩展功能,目前已拥有超过3000个功能扩展:
# 查看可用技能
openclaw skills list
# 安装技能
openclaw skills install 技能名称
9.2 自定义配置
高级用户可编辑配置文件~/.openclaw/openclaw.json,自定义:
- 模型参数(温度、最大token数)
- 安全策略(操作确认阈值)
- 日志级别
- 自定义技能路径
9.3 监控与维护
# 查看实时日志
openclaw logs follow
# 性能监控
openclaw metrics
# 备份配置
cp -r ~/.openclaw ~/.openclaw_backup
十、总结
OpenClaw作为一款革命性的AI智能体工具,将AI从“建议者”转变为“执行者”,显著提升了工作效率。通过本教程,你应该已经成功完成了OpenClaw的安装、配置和基础测试。
下一步建议:
- 从简单任务开始:先尝试文件整理、网页信息提取等基础任务
- 逐步增加复杂度:熟悉后尝试自动化工作流
- 探索社区资源:访问https://github.com/VoltAgent/awesome-openclaw-skills获取更多技能
- 参与贡献:OpenClaw是开源项目,欢迎提交Issue和PR
记住,OpenClaw不是全知全能的数字分身,而是一个需要你聪明引导的个人AI管家。合理使用,让它成为你工作和生活的得力助手!
官方资源:
- 官网:https://openclaw.ai/
- GitHub:https://github.com/openclaw/openclaw
- 中文文档:https://docs.openclaw.ai/zh-CN
- 中文社区:https://clawd.org.cn/
如果在安装过程中遇到问题,欢迎在评论区留言,我会尽力为你解答!
A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。
更多推荐


所有评论(0)